Ingredients of Nutter Butters Recipe
- 1 1⁄2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p. baking soda
- 1 tsp. cornstarch
- 1⁄2 cup unsalted butter, room temperature
- 1 cup light brown sugar
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 egg
- 1 tsp. vanilla extract
- Peanut Butter Filling
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 3⁄4 cups confectioner’s sugar
- 1⁄4 cup heavy cream
- 1 1⁄2 tsp. vanilla

Directions Step By Step of Nutter Butters Recipe
- Before you start, it is important to set your oven to 350°F and place a sheet pan with a parchment paper lining on the countertop. You can do these steps and set them aside temporarily.
- In a bowl, blend the flour, baking soda, and cornstarch using a whisk. You can do this part and set it aside.
- In another big bowl, first, using an electric stand mixer equipped with a paddle attachment, blend the butter and the brown sugar until you achieve a creamed texture. Whip them for roughly 2 minutes or until they are airy and fluffy without any lumps.
- Include the peanut butter in the sugar and butter mixture and/or cream it smoothly. Use a spatula to scrape the sides of the bowl.
- Mix the egg and vanilla with the butter mixture and continue mixing till it forms a fluffy, homogeneous mass.
- Add the dry ingredients to the wet and mix just until a nice, soft dough forms. Scrape down the sides of the bowl one last time to make sure everything has been mixed well.
- Divide dough into pieces of about 1 Tbsp. each. Form a ball with each part of the dough. Each ball of dough is rolled into a log form of about 3″ long. With the palm of your hand, flatten each log into a long disk shape. Use your fingers to tigh the middle sides of the log to form a peanut shape.
- As soon as you are done with the peanut form, you can position the cookie on the sheet that is prepared, and then you should use a fork to create grid marks evenly up and down the cookie.
- After that, you will do the same for each cookie. The cookie will be set on the prepared cookie sheet with two cookies separated by 2", and then it will be baked for 9-10 minutes or until the edges are golden brown.
- Make sure that the cookies are completely cooled down before you put the filling in.
- Peanut Butter Filling
- The preparation of the peanut butter filling is done by mixing the peanut butter, confectioner’s sugar, heavy cream, and vanilla through the creaming method. The creaming is done until the mixture looks very smooth without lumps. Add more heavy cream if your mixture is too thick (this may vary depending on the peanut butter brand).
- Transfer the filling to a piping bag and fill the bottom side of one cookie at a time, then top with another cookie facing up. Repeat this process for each cookie.

Homemade Nutter Butters
Equipment
- Mixing bowls
- pan
- 9×13-inch baking dish
- oven
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 tbsp cornstarch
- 1 tbsp Baking soda
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, room temperature
- 1 cup light brown sugar
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 Eggs
- 1 tbsp vanilla extract
Peanut Butter Filling
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 3/4 cup confectioner’s sugar
- 1/4 cup heavy cream
- 1 1/2 tbsp vanilla
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F and line a cookie sheet with parchment paper then set aside
- In a medium-sized b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and cornstarch. Set aside.
- In a separate large bowl using an electric mixer or a stand mixer fit with the paddle attachment, cream together the butter and brown sugar. Mix for about 2 minutes or until light and fluffy with no lumps.
- Add the peanut butter to the sugar and butter mixture and continue to cream together until smooth. Use a silicone spatula to scrape down the sides of the bowl as you go.
- Add the egg and vanilla to the butter mixture and continue to mix until well combined. Add the dry ingredients to the wet and mix just until a nice, soft dough forms. Scrape down the sides of the bowl one last time to ensure that everything has been incorporated evenly.
- Scoop the dough into about 1 Tbsp. sized pieces. Roll each piece into a ball. Next, roll each dough ball into a log about 3″ long. Use the palm of your hand to flatten each log into a long disk shape. Pinch the middle sides of the log to create the peanut shape. Use the images above to help guide you.
- Once the peanut shapes are ready, place the cookie onto the prepared cookie sheet then use a fork to create score marks evenly up and down the cookie.
- Repeat these steps for each cookie. Place each cookie about 2″ apart on the prepared cookie sheet then bake for 9-10 minutes or until golden brown on the edges.
- Allow the cookies to cool completely before filling.
Peanut Butter Filling
- To make the peanut butter filling, cream together the peanut butter, confectioner’s sugar, heavy cream, and vanilla. Cream until the mixture is nice and smooth and there are no lumps. Add more heavy cream if your mixture is too thick (this may vary on peanut butter brands).
- Transfer the filling to a piping bag and fill the bottom side of one cookie at a time then top with another cookie facing up. Repeat this process for each cookie.
